  A puddle flange is a simple yet essential fitting used in civil construction to prevent water leakage where pipes pass through concrete structures. In RCC (Reinforced Cement Concrete) slabs, these flanges act as a seal that stops water from migrating along the outer surface of a pipe. Whether you are working on water tanks, basements, lift pits, or underground pipelines, installing a puddle flange correctly ensures waterproofing and structural durability. Introduction: The MS vs GI Pipe Dilemma

When it comes to industrial pipeline selection, MS (Mild Steel) pipes and GI (Galvanized Iron) pipes are two widely used options. While they may look similar, their performance, coating, durability, and pricing differ significantly.

This guide helps industrial buyers decide which pipe fits their Udyog (industrial) application better in 2025.


What is MS Pipe?

MS (Mild Steel) pipes are made of low-carbon steel and are used in general applications that don’t require corrosion resistance.

Key Features

  • Made from low carbon steel (0.05–0.25%)

  • High weldability and malleability

  • Economical and strong


What is GI Pipe?

GI (Galvanized Iron) pipes are MS pipes coated with zinc to prevent rusting. This makes them suitable for outdoor and corrosive environments.

Key Features

  • Zinc-coated for corrosion resistance

  • Long life in water and outdoor environments

  • Preferred for water lines, agriculture, and plumbing


MS Pipe vs GI Pipe – Detailed Comparison

ParameterMS PipeGI Pipe
MaterialMild SteelMild Steel + Zinc Coating
Corrosion ResistanceLowHigh
StrengthHighSlightly lower (due to coating)
WeldabilityExcellentDifficult (zinc layer can burn)
Cost₹62–₹85 per kg₹80–₹110 per kg
Use CasesStructural, Scaffolding, FabricationWater Supply, Outdoor Piping, Fencing
Lifespan (Unprotected)Moderate (can rust)Long (coating delays rust)
MaintenanceMay need paintingLow maintenance

Which One Is Better for Industrial Use?

Choose MS Pipe If:

  • You're working on structural frameworks or indoor piping.

  • You require strong weld joints or customized fabrication.

  • Cost is a key factor, and rust is not a major concern.

Choose GI Pipe If:

  • The pipeline will face moisture, outdoor conditions, or water.

  • You need low-maintenance, rust-resistant installations.

  • Application involves drinking water, agriculture, or plumbing.

FAQs

Q1. Can I use MS pipes for water lines?

Ans: You can, but MS pipes may corrode over time. It’s better to use GI pipes for water transport.

Q2. Are GI pipes stronger than MS pipes?

Ans: MS pipes are slightly stronger structurally. GI pipes prioritize corrosion resistance over strength.

Q3. Can GI pipes be welded?

Ans: Yes, but welding requires removal of the zinc coating at the joints and adequate safety due to zinc fumes.

Q4. Are MS pipes cheaper than GI pipes?

Ans: Yes. MS pipes are more economical, making them suitable for budget-focused industrial projects.

Q5. Which pipe is better for agriculture?

Ans: GI pipes are better due to longer life, corrosion resistance, and suitability for water flow.
